#80e748 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#80e748 is composed of 50.2% red, 90.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 98.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 59.4%. #80e748 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#01cf00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#80e748 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#80e748 has RGB values of R:128, G:231,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 8447816.

Shades and Tints of #80e748
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030801 is the darkest color, while #f8f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#80e748
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959f90 is the less saturated color, while #79ff30 is the most saturated one.
